The Common Sleeping areas

The Common bedrooms and loft have themes for each room. Each room is decorated with vintage pictures, handmade quilts, and stenciling. Quilts are changed seasonally: Royal Blue Snowflake (Winter) and Nature (Summer). Currently displayed on this page are both seasons' quilts.

"Lodge" Master Bedroom

Slumber your cares away on this beautiful, handmade lodgepole queen sized bed covered with handmade quilts and The Common signature pillows. This interesting room features a cozy alcove with a desk and chair and a phone line connection suitable for a laptop computer (DSL service is available with advance notice.).

"Forest Room" Second Master Bedroom

A lodge iron sleigh bed cradles a queen mattress in this "Forest Room". Great for a second couple who needs to be near the children's room. Phone line suitable for a laptop computer (DSL service is available with advance notice.).

"Canopy of Stars" Children's Bedroom

This charming bedroom will be the delight for boys and girls and children at heart. Two ranch style bunk beds present four twin beds featuring trundle drawers for storage.

"Freedom" Loft

Named for all of our family's military veterans, some who served and still serve, some who fought, and some who died for our country's freedom. Enjoy your slumber on a double bed sized futon under their watchful protection. Be the FIRST to see the spectacular view the next morning through The Common's many floor to ceiling windows showcasing the valley and Brundage Mountain. TV/VCR are included in the loft.
